Prioritize properties with well-maintained pools and updated equipment to avoid costly repairs. Verify pool permits and compliance with California safety codes, including required barriers and drainage systems. Hire a specialized pool inspector before purchase. Consider proximity to schools, parks, and shopping centers. Pre-approve financing and get pre-inspections to strengthen offers in this competitive market. Highlight your pool as a premium lifestyle feature in listings and marketing materials. Schedule professional pool cleaning and landscaping before showings. Obtain pool maintenance records and certifications to build buyer confidence. Ensure proper permits are documented and accessible. Consider pool resurfacing if showing wear. Price competitively based on recent comparable sales with similar amenities. Stage outdoor spaces to showcase entertainment potential.
